Transaction 74756cae4f6dcf79fa930f02a49822edf90c49d0a32d83fc52a5f083373b875b

1 Input
2 Outputs
  • 74756cae4f6dcf79fa930f02a49822edf90c49d0a32d83fc52a5f083373b875b:0
  • value  39997080
    address  3BMEXZV2f3wp5toohd2DmnUwKscsrNUXeP
  • 74756cae4f6dcf79fa930f02a49822edf90c49d0a32d83fc52a5f083373b875b:1
  • value  26870702
    address  bc1q2xd42e0ql6cs79qfczd9zeeuwnuqmehr7ua57w